Subject: [PATCH v3 03/44] SUNRPC: The transmitted message must lie in the RPCSEC window of validity
Date: Mon, 17 Sep 2018 09:02:54 -0400	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20180917130335.112832-4-trond.myklebust@hammerspace.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20180917130335.112832-3-trond.myklebust@hammerspace.com>

If a message has been encoded using RPCSEC_GSS, the server is
maintaining a window of sequence numbers that it considers valid.
The client should normally be tracking that window, and needs to
verify that the sequence number used by the message being transmitted
still lies inside the window of validity.

So far, we've been able to assume this condition would be realised
automatically, since the client has been encoding the message only
after taking the socket lock. Once we change that condition, we
will need the explicit check.

diff --git a/net/sunrpc/auth_gss/auth_gss.c b/net/sunrpc/auth_gss/auth_gss.c
index 21c0aa0a0d1d..c898a7c75e84 100644
--- a/net/sunrpc/auth_gss/auth_gss.c
+++ b/net/sunrpc/auth_gss/auth_gss.c
@@ -1984,6 +1984,46 @@ gss_unwrap_req_decode(kxdrdproc_t decode, struct rpc_rqst *rqstp,
 	return decode(rqstp, &xdr, obj);
 }
 
+static bool
+gss_seq_is_newer(u32 new, u32 old)
+{
+	return (s32)(new - old) > 0;
+}
+
+static bool
+gss_xmit_need_reencode(struct rpc_task *task)
+{
+	struct rpc_rqst *req = task->tk_rqstp;
+	struct rpc_cred *cred = req->rq_cred;
+	struct gss_cl_ctx *ctx = gss_cred_get_ctx(cred);
+	u32 win, seq_xmit;
+	bool ret = true;
+
+	if (!ctx)
+		return true;
+
+	if (gss_seq_is_newer(req->rq_seqno, READ_ONCE(ctx->gc_seq)))
+		goto out;
+
+	seq_xmit = READ_ONCE(ctx->gc_seq_xmit);
+	while (gss_seq_is_newer(req->rq_seqno, seq_xmit)) {
+		u32 tmp = seq_xmit;
+
+		seq_xmit = cmpxchg(&ctx->gc_seq_xmit, tmp, req->rq_seqno);
+		if (seq_xmit == tmp) {
+			ret = false;
+			goto out;
+		}
+	}
+
+	win = ctx->gc_win;
+	if (win > 0)
+		ret = !gss_seq_is_newer(req->rq_seqno, seq_xmit - win);
+out:
+	gss_put_ctx(ctx);
+	return ret;
+}
+
 static int
 gss_unwrap_resp(struct rpc_task *task,
 		kxdrdproc_t decode, void *rqstp, __be32 *p, void *obj)
@@ -2052,6 +2092,7 @@ static const struct rpc_credops gss_credops = {
 	.crunwrap_resp		= gss_unwrap_resp,
 	.crkey_timeout		= gss_key_timeout,
 	.crstringify_acceptor	= gss_stringify_acceptor,
+	.crneed_reencode	= gss_xmit_need_reencode,
 };
